Oracle connect by prior where

WebOct 17, 2016 · Performance of oracle hierarchical “connect by prior” or recursive CTE query I need to track the path of documents that get rolled into each other. To do this, I built a … http://www.dba-oracle.com/t_advanced_sql_connect_by_clause.htm

SYS_CONNECT_BY_PATH ROOT tips - dba-oracle.com

WebJan 25, 2024 · Connect by PRIOR in Oracle User_CCHZN Jan 25 2024 Hi Friends, I have a table sample and has below data C1 C2 a b b c c d d e j i If I pass the input parameter as … WebJul 11, 2013 · START WITH and CONNECT BY PRIOR GopalaKrishna Jul 11 2013 — edited Jul 12 2013 Hi, Database: Oracle 11g 1. SELECT empno,ename,mgr FROM emp START … income tax new amendments https://joshuacrosby.com

recursive query - connect by prior oracle - Stack …

WebBook a room for Oracle Health Conference. Hotel booking is available at registration and through your attendee portal. The housing deadline is August 22. From August 23 to September 5, registration changes won’t be accepted online. Your hotel confirmation number will be emailed to you approximately two weeks prior to your arrival date. WebCONNECT_BY_ROOT is a unary operator that is valid only in hierarchical queries. When you qualify a column with this operator, Oracle returns the column value using data from the … WebThis is defined using the CONNECT BY .. PRIOR clause, which defines how the current row (child) relates to a prior row (parent). In addition, the START WITH clause can be used to define the root node (s) of the hierarchy. Hierarchical queries come with operators, pseudocolumns and functions to help make sense of the hierarchy. income tax netbanking

CONNECT BY Snowflake Documentation

Category:How to run hierarchical queries in Oracle and PostgreSQL

Tags:Oracle connect by prior where

Oracle connect by prior where

Connecting to Oracle Database

WebMay 23, 2024 · CONNECT BY: It specifies the relationship between parent rows and child rows of the hierarchy. PRIOR: It’s a unary operator and it is used to achieve the recursive condition i.e the actual walking. The results of the above query will be as follows: The execution takes place as follows: a.> START WITH conditions determines the point of start. WebJul 4, 2009 · CONNECT BY clause is applied before applying WHERE condition in the same query. Thus, WHERE constraints won't help optimize CONNECT BY. For example, the …

Oracle connect by prior where

Did you know?

WebMar 22, 2024 · connect by parent_id = prior concept_id and exists (..) While the second one has only one condition. connect by parent_id = prior concept_id; The part of the query that … WebOracle Autonomous Database includes several deployment options: Oracle Autonomous Database on Shared Exadata Infrastructure (ADB-S) Oracle Autonomous Database on Dedicated Exadata

WebThe connect_by_iscycle pseudo-column will show you which rows contain the cycle: SQL> SELECT ename "Employee", CONNECT_BY_ISCYCLE "Cycle", 2 LEVEL, SYS_CONNECT_BY_PATH (ename, '/') "Path" 3 FROM scott.emp 4 SEE CODE DEPOT FOR FULL SCRIPT 5 START WITH ename = 'KING' 6 CONNECT BY NOCYCLE PRIOR empno = … WebPRIOR identifies the parent row in the column. The PRIOR keyword can be on either side of the = operator. CONNECT BY PRIOR id=parentid will return different results to CONNECT …

WebJan 30, 2024 · A hierarchical SELECT statement (using CONNECT BY) can be a powerful way to query hierarchical data. Since version 10g, hierarchical SELECT statements have had … WebFeb 16, 2024 · 1 Answer. When you have CONNECT BY without START WITH, the root, starting points of the recursion are all the rows of the table. It is useful if you want to find …

WebIn Oracle, you can use CONNECT BY PRIOR clause of the SELECT statement to build hierarchical queries. Microsoft SQL Server (MSSQL) allows you to use Recursive …

WebApr 14, 2024 · 获取验证码. 密码. 登录 inch photographyWebApr 26, 2012 · This condition is equivalent to the Oracle's PRIOR clause, choosing the new row to add to the result set: the row should be a direct child of another already added row. ... This actually works a bit differently from Oracle's CONNECT BY NOCYCLE (but similarly to the newer cycle detection code in Oracle 11g R2): we can only detect a cycle upon ... income tax new amendments 2021-22WebJun 7, 2024 · Most of the demo's on 'Connect By' feature a single table and the 'Connect' Clause is simplyConnect By Prior emp_id = mgr_id or similar. However I have a situation whereby I need to join several tables together before. ... So, the order Oracle Database processes connect by is: A join, if present, is evaluated first, whether the join is ... inch pipe flare toolWebJun 8, 2024 · In Oracle, START WITH/CONNECT BY is used to create a singly linked list structure starting at a given sentinel row. The linked list may take the form of a tree, and has no balancing requirement. To illustrate, let’s start with a query, and presume that the table has 5 rows in it. inch perfect trials bikesWebDec 23, 2010 · CONNECT BY PRIOR EMPNO = /* current */ MGR that will take all of the PRIOR records (the start with at first) and find all records such that the MGR column … inch photoWebFeb 17, 2012 · One way would be to do two CONNECT BY queries; one without a START WITH clause (like the one above) that gets the aggregates, and the other with a START WITH clause (like your original query), that is in the right order, and has columns such as level_label and level. We could join the result sets and get exactly what we want. income tax nature of businessWeboracle connect by相关信息,oracle中start with和connect by的用法理解connect by 子句:连接条件。关键词prior,prior跟父节点列parentid放在一起,就是往父结点方向遍历;prior跟子结点列subid放在一起,则往叶子结点方向遍历, parentid、subid两列谁放在“=”前... inch pixel 変換